LETTER TO THE EDITOR: Youth unemployment in Honiara

Dear Editor– I appreciate the opportunity to voice my concerns regarding the alarming increase in unemployment among youth in Honiara. As with many developing nations, our city is grappling with soaring rates of youth unemployment and underemployment, which poses significant challenges to our community and may precipitate undesirable social repercussions.

As a student and concerned young citizen, I fear that without decisive action, this trend will only exacerbate in the future. Several factors contribute to this predicament, including the scarcity of job opportunities, inadequate access to education, urban migration, and a mismatch between the skills possessed by youth and the demands of available employment opportunities. Sadly, many youths are compelled to settle for unskilled labor, such as becoming bus conductors, drivers, or working in barber shops.

Despite these formidable challenges, there exist viable alternatives aimed at mitigating these issues. One such solution involves expanding vocational programs with reduced tuition fees to ensure accessibility for all. Furthermore, there is a pressing need to stimulate job creation, particularly in sectors such as tourism, agriculture, and small-scale enterprises within the public sector.

I implore the newly formed government not to overlook the plight of our youth in its development agenda. We exercised our democratic rights during the recent elections, entrusting our leaders to address the pressing issues confronting our generation. It is my fervent hope that you will prioritize youth employment in your policies and initiatives, thereby fostering a brighter future for all residents of Honiara.

Rockson Urabana

USP Student
